Why Do People Fast Anyway?
Alright, let’s start with the basics. Why do people fast in the first place? It’s not just about skipping breakfast or lunch. Fasting has been a part of human culture for centuries, and it’s practiced for a variety of reasons. Some folks fast for religious reasons, others for health benefits, and some just do it as a form of self-discipline. Here’s a quick breakdown:
- Religious Fasting: Many religions, like Islam, Christianity, Judaism, and Buddhism, incorporate fasting as a way to connect with the divine. It’s often seen as a time for reflection, prayer, and spiritual growth.
- Health Fasting: In recent years, intermittent fasting has become super popular. People are fasting to lose weight, improve digestion, and even boost brain function. It’s all about giving your body a break from constant digestion.
- Personal Growth: Some people fast as a way to challenge themselves, build willpower, or simply take a break from the hustle and bustle of daily life. It’s like hitting the reset button for your mind and body.
So, as you can see, fasting isn’t one-size-fits-all. It’s deeply personal, and the reasons behind it can vary widely. Now, let’s zoom in on January 27, 2025, and see what makes this date special.

Health Benefits of Fasting
Now, let’s switch gears and talk about the health side of things. Fasting isn’t just a spiritual practice; it’s also a powerful tool for improving your physical well-being. Here are some of the benefits you might experience:
- Weight Loss: Fasting can help you shed those extra pounds by reducing calorie intake and boosting metabolism.
- Improved Digestion: Giving your digestive system a break can help reduce bloating, acid reflux, and other gut issues.
- Enhanced Brain Function: Studies show that fasting can improve cognitive function and even protect against neurodegenerative diseases like Alzheimer’s.
Of course, it’s important to approach fasting with caution, especially if you have underlying health conditions. Always consult with a healthcare professional before starting any new fasting regimen.
How to Prepare for a Successful Fast
Decided to give fasting a try on January 27, 2025? Great! But before you dive in, it’s important to prepare properly.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you make the most of your fasting experience:
Step 1: Set Your Intentions
Why are you fasting? Is it for spiritual growth, health benefits, or personal reflection? Knowing your “why” will keep you motivated throughout the process.
Step 2: Choose the Right Type of Fast
There are different types of fasting, so pick the one that suits your needs:
- Water Fast: Only consume water during your fasting period.
- Intermittent Fasting: Cycle between eating and fasting windows.
- Juice Fast: Drink freshly squeezed juices to nourish your body while fasting.
Step 3: Plan Your Meals
If you’re doing intermittent fasting, plan your meals carefully to ensure you’re getting enough nutrients. Focus on whole, unprocessed foods like fruits, veggies, lean proteins, and healthy fats.
Common Misconceptions About Fasting
There’s a lot of misinformation out there about fasting, so let’s clear up some common myths:
- Myth #1: Fasting is Dangerous: Not true! When done properly, fasting can be perfectly safe for most people.
- Myth #2: You’ll Lose Muscle Mass: Only if you don’t consume enough protein during your eating windows.
- Myth #3: Fasting is Only for Religious People: Nope! Anyone can benefit from fasting, regardless of their beliefs.
Knowledge is power, so arm yourself with the facts before you start fasting.
